Автор Тема: Сео и постраничная навигация  (Прочитано 756 раз)

11 Июнь 2016, 11:10:34
  • Новичок
  • *
  • Сообщений: 14
  • Репутация: +0/-0
  • Сообщество PrestaShop
    • Просмотр профиля
В категории на одной странице отображается 21 товар, организована постраничная навигация. Суть в том, что meta теги, заголовки h1 и описание на второй и последующих страницах повторяются. Хотелось бы убрать meta теги и описание со всех страниц постраничной навигации, кроме первой. Сначала хотел заблокировать индексцаию через robots.txt (Disallow: /*p), но это плохо повлияет на распределение веса по страницам. Может кто-то уже решил задачу?!
11 Июнь 2016, 11:58:25
Ответ #1
  • Партнер
  • Старожил
  • ****
  • Сообщений: 313
  • Репутация: +13/-0
  • SEO оптимизация сайтов, интенет-магазинов.
    • Просмотр профиля
Для страниц можно изменить мета теги. Для этого в классе Meta.php заменить
if (empty($row['meta_description'])
     $row['meta_description'] = strip_tags($row['description']);
на
if($page_number > 1){
    $paginate_descr = "Тут можно поисковый запрос вставить или же текст из описания, или спец поле".$page_number." : ";
}else{
    $paginate_descr = '';
}
if(empty($row['meta_description'])){
    $row['meta_description'] = strip_tags($paginate_descr.$row['description']);
}else{
    $row['meta_description'] = strip_tags($paginate_descr.$row['meta_description']);
}
Поисковая оптимизация, SEO  оптимизация сайтов, интенет-магазинов.  Работа на результат –  вывод в топ, увеличение посещяемости и увеличение продаж.
11 Июнь 2016, 12:05:49
Ответ #2
  • Партнер
  • Старожил
  • ****
  • Сообщений: 313
  • Репутация: +13/-0
  • SEO оптимизация сайтов, интенет-магазинов.
    • Просмотр профиля
Поисковая оптимизация, SEO  оптимизация сайтов, интенет-магазинов.  Работа на результат –  вывод в топ, увеличение посещяемости и увеличение продаж.